Virial expansion for almost diagonal random matrices

Energy level statistics of Hermitian random matrices with Gaussian independent random entries is studied for a generic ensemble of almost diagonal random matrices with and . We perform a regular expansion of the spectral form-factor in powers of with the coefficients that take into account interaction of (m+1) energy levels. To calculate , we develop a diagrammatic technique which is based on the Trotter formula and on the combinatorial problem of graph edges coloring with (m+1) colors. Expressions for and in terms of infinite series are found for a generic function in the Gaussian Orthogonal Ensemble (GOE), the Gaussian Unitary Ensemble (GUE) and in the crossover between them (the almost unitary Gaussian ensemble). The Rosenzweig-Porter and power-law banded matrix ensembles are considered as examples.
